The appropriate historical name for the community is either Cracking Barnet or High Barnet. The area advantages from superb transportation links, including High Barnet tube terminal, which is on the North line, and the A1, which runs to the west of the community.The name of the area is thought to be derived from the Brokeman family, that possessed one of 2 mansion homes in the location. Nonetheless, its modern growth can be mapped to the land from the various other estate (The Gobions estate) being purchased by a building syndicate to build a traveler town in the 1920s not simply houses, but additionally a golf club, resort, and train terminal.
Initially, Patience Moffat, the little girl of a regional entomologist, was surviving a ranch in the location. While eating her curds and whey, a spider came down from the ceiling and scared her. A poet was staying with them and, with a modified name, created the rhyme. This connection is still celebrated in your area a spider's web is consisted of in the Brookmans Park School badge.
And previous Spurs and England footballer Martin Chivers ran the Brookmans Park Resort for greater than a years from the mid-80s to the mid-90s. This town was originally owned by the abbey of Ely and was known as Haethfeld. The Hatfield of today matured around Hatfield House (visualized over), the genealogical seat of the Cecil family.

Hatfield additionally boosted in dimension after it was assigned a New Town following the Second Globe Battle. This suggests that Hatfield has a great deal of modernist design and open areas, when contrasted to adjoining areas. Its modern and well-serviced transportation links, including the A1 (M), make it an eye-catching location to commute to London.
Famous individuals from Hatfield consist of EastEnders actress Letitia Dean and movie supervisor Individual Ritchie, who were both born in the town. Enchanting writer Dame Barbara Cartland likewise lived there for years. Barnet has a lengthy and rich history, with proof of Roman settlements in the location and Hendon pointed out in the 1086 Domesday Book. YOURURL.com Once a noticeable trading path quiting point in and out of London, Barnet has a variety of historical inns and clubs from that time.

Baernet is believed to indicate a location gotten rid of by burning. Arkley and Hadley, to the west and north, might have consisted of negotiations that precede Chipping Barnet as they appear in a rare boundary description from 1005. Little is known of the town of Barnet before King John gave a Charter to the Lord of the Mansion on 23 August 1199 for a market to be held here once a week.

At the same time, the Queen provided a charter for a twice-yearly Fair to be held below for the sale of livestock (generally cattle and steeds). The Fair continues to this day every September in Mays Lane, although in a much-reduced form and the term Barnet (Fair) is still utilized to suggest 'hair' in Cockney rhyming vernacular.

Chipping Barnet was likewise recognized as High Barnet by the seventeenth century and has actually remained to be known by both names since
Wilbraham's Almshouses at the edge of Hadley Environment-friendly and Dury Roadway were integrated in 1616 by Sir Roger Wilbraham for '6 corroded housekeepers'. In 1656 the initial well-house was erected on Barnet Common (behind the medical facility today) to confine a spring that was believed to have alleviative buildings. Samuel Pepys recorded his initial visit in his journal in 1664.

To the north of Hadley is our extremely own manor house, Wrotham Park, a Palladian estate made by Isaac Ware in 1754 and developed by Admiral John Byng, the fourth boy of Admiral Sir George Byng. It click is a personal home and is still owned by the Byng family members. Barnet address. It is open to the public by consultation on Open Home Weekend Break in September every year

The Victorians created new buildings in the centre of Chipping Barnet and at New Barnet. The greatest current single advancement was the structure of the Dollis Valley Estate in the late sixties/early seventies on the previous sewer deals with the south side of Mays Lane. The regeneration of this estate, including the demolition of all the apartments and maisonettes has actually been prepared for some years.
This involved demolition of the previous Methodist Church on the High Street (hence the name), constructing Wesley Hall and Chipping Barnet Collection and prolonging Stapylton Road to fulfill St Albans Road. The Green Belt was marked in 1945 and most of the older structures of Chipping Barnet and Monken Hadley are now safeguarded through statutory listing or by Sanctuary status.
